Job description

What will you do?
  • Ensure all design engineer activity is aligned with latest conformed construction documents prior to installation
  • Able to modify and update design drawings and maintain red line documents
  • Collaborates with project manager and procurement personnel on purchasing activity and monitors budget risks Assist the PM in material procurement
  • Ensure materials are being delivered to site or subcontractors for installation.
  • Validate hardware and project installation meet design
  • Re-commission devices, equipment, and software as required
  • Diagnose communication problems, troubleshoot and track software and hardware issues
  • Participate in field quality control or safety audits and review analysis and results
  • Coordinate with on-site contractors for the installation of equipment based on shop drawings
  • Act as primary point of contact for subcontractors during installation phase
  • Coordinate and address any issues during installation phase independently
  • Collaborate with the Project Manager to coordinate projects through the installation phase
  • Provide feedback to the Project Manager for manpower requirements
  • Make sure that installation tracking sheets are updated regularly
  • Prepare customer-training manuals and provide customized training
  • Contribute to a complete operations to service turnover process
  • Responsible for overall system functionality/performance.
  • Setup outside ISP connections and remote connectivity to customer sites

What qualifications will make you successful?
  • This position is typically held by an individual that has at least 4 years' experience as a Systems Application Engineer with related industry knowledge, and demonstrated communication skills for interfacing directly with customers and other trades.
  • This individual should have experience with HVAC and security installations and be proficient in all types of building systems and application of our technology.
  • Shall be capable of coordination of other project team activities on site, including coordination with other trades, commissioning agents, and customers.
  • This position is responsible for project coordination, safety, software checkout, commissioning, and software troubleshooting.
  • Ensures that daily activities on site for projects are completed and regular progress on projects are communicated to the project manager.
